Thai-An Nguyen is a scholar working on Food Science, Biotechnology and Infectious Diseases. According to data from OpenAlex, Thai-An Nguyen has authored 17 papers receiving a total of 440 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 16 papers in Food Science, 8 papers in Biotechnology and 7 papers in Infectious Diseases. Recurrent topics in Thai-An Nguyen’s work include Salmonella and Campylobacter epidemiology (15 papers), Food Safety and Hygiene (9 papers) and Listeria monocytogenes in Food Safety (8 papers). Thai-An Nguyen is often cited by papers focused on Salmonella and Campylobacter epidemiology (15 papers), Food Safety and Hygiene (9 papers) and Listeria monocytogenes in Food Safety (8 papers). Thai-An Nguyen collaborates with scholars based in United States and United Kingdom. Thai-An Nguyen's co-authors include Casey Barton Behravesh, Colin Basler, Tara C. Anderson, Anandi N. Sheth, Cheryl A. Bopp, Donald L. Zink, Thomas M. Gomez, Michael Lynch, Robert M. Hoekstra and Nehal Patel and has published in prestigious journals such as Clinical Infectious Diseases, Emerging infectious diseases and MMWR Morbidity and Mortality Weekly Report.
